CVE-2016-6540 (GCVE-0-2016-6540)
Vulnerability from cvelistv5
Published
2018-07-06 21:00
Modified
2024-08-06 01:36
Severity ?
CWE
  • CWE-306 - Missing Authentication for Critical Function
Summary
Unauthenticated access to the cloud-based service maintained by TrackR Bravo is allowed for querying or sending GPS data for any Trackr device by using the tracker ID number which can be discovered as described in CVE-2016-6539. Updated apps, version 5.1.6 for iOS and 2.2.5 for Android, have been released by the vendor to address the vulnerabilities in CVE-2016-6538, CVE-2016-6539, CVE-2016-6540 and CVE-2016-6541.

CVE-2016-6541 (GCVE-0-2016-6541)
Vulnerability from cvelistv5
Published
2018-07-06 21:00
Modified
2024-08-06 01:36
Severity ?
CWE
  • CWE-306 - Missing Authentication for Critical Function
Summary
TrackR Bravo device allows unauthenticated pairing, which enables unauthenticated connected applications to write to various device attributes. Updated apps, version 5.1.6 for iOS and 2.2.5 for Android, have been released by the vendor to address the vulnerabilities in CVE-2016-6538, CVE-2016-6539, CVE-2016-6540 and CVE-2016-6541.

CVE-2016-6538 (GCVE-0-2016-6538)
Vulnerability from cvelistv5
Published
2018-07-06 21:00
Modified
2024-08-06 01:36
Severity ?
CWE
  • CWE-313 - Cleartext Storage in a File or on Disk
Summary
The TrackR Bravo mobile app stores the account password used to authenticate to the cloud API in cleartext in the cache.db file. Updated apps, version 5.1.6 for iOS and 2.2.5 for Android, have been released by the vendor to address the vulnerabilities in CVE-2016-6538, CVE-2016-6539, CVE-2016-6540 and CVE-2016-6541.
